Translate JSON files. Instantly.

Drop your .json file. Get clean, context-aware translations in seconds.No APIs. No config. Just drag, drop, done.

translation-preview.json
Original (English)
EN
{
"WelcomeScreen.greeting":"Hello there,",
"WelcomeScreen.title":"Welcome to Translayte",
"Navigation.home":"Home Dashboard",
"Navigation.about":"About Our Team",
"Navigation.contact":"Contact Support",
"Buttons.submit":"Submit Form",
"Buttons.cancel":"Cancel Action",
"Forms.email":"Email address field",
"Forms.password":"Secure password",
"Notification.saved":"Changes saved successfully"
}
Translated (ES)
ES
{
"WelcomeScreen.greeting":"Holla allí,",
"WelcomeScreen.title":"Bienvenido a Translayte",
"Navigation.home":"Panel principal",
"Navigation.about":"Sobre nuestro equipo",
"Navigation.contact":"Soporte de contacto",
"Buttons.submit":"Enviar formulario",
"Buttons.cancel":"Cancelar acción",
"Forms.email":"Campo de correo",
"Forms.password":"Contraseña segura",
"Notification.saved":"Cambios guardados con éxito"
}
Also translating to:

How It Works

Step 1: Upload your file

Drag and drop any JSON translation file — we support common formats used in React, i18next, Next.js, Vue, and more.

Step 2: Choose target languages

Pick from 13+ supported languages — context-aware AI ensures accuracy across phrases.

Step 3: Download translated JSON

Instantly get ready-to-use files you can plug back into your app.

Why Developers Choose Translayte

Designed by developers, for developers — we solve the localization headaches you actually have.

Lightning Fast

Translate thousands of keys in seconds.

Developer Friendly

No setup, no API — just upload and go.

Context-Aware

Maintains meaning across short strings and UI components.

Copy-Paste Ready

Keeps your original key structure and formatting.

Everything You Need, Nothing You Don't

Supports nested JSON

Complex structures? No problem.

Auto-detects base language

We figure out what you're starting with.

Handles placeholders and variables

Variables like {name} and %s stay intact.

Preserves whitespace and formatting

Your output looks as clean as your input.

Full preview before download

Review translations before exporting.

Works with i18next, Next.js, Vue i18n

Compatible with popular frameworks.

Fast export to .json or .js

Get the format you need, instantly.

No hidden fees

Transparent, flat pricing—no surprises.

"Saved us hours on every localization update."

Frontend Lead

SaaS Startup

"Finally a translation tool that doesn't get in my way."

Solo Indie Dev

Open Source Contributor

Simple, Transparent Pricing

No surprise fees. No complicated tiers. Just what you need.

Free Plan

Perfect for small projects and personal use

$0/month
  • Translate up to 69 keys/month
  • 3 target languages per file
  • No credit card required
POPULAR

Pro Plan

For teams and businesses

$13/month
  • Unlimited translations
  • History panel
  • Priority support
  • Early access to new features